Shipping Options: FCL vs. LCL
There are two main shipping options to consider for sending window cleaning machines from China to Japan: Full Container Load (FCL) and Less than Container Load (LCL).
FCL (Full Container Load)
FCL shipments involve renting an entire container, either 20FT or 40FT, for the transportation of your goods. This option is ideal for larger shipments, as it provides a dedicated space, ensuring that the goods are transported safely without sharing space with other cargo. The FCL service can be arranged as a CIF (Cost, Insurance, and Freight) delivery, which means the seller covers the cost of the goods, shipping, and insurance until they arrive at Maizuru Port. The estimated transit time from Guangzhou or Shenzhen to Maizuru Port is approximately 10 days by sea.LCL (Less than Container Load)
LCL shipments are suitable for smaller shipments that do not require an entire container. In this case, your cargo will be consolidated with other shipments in the same container. While this option is cost-effective for smaller volumes, it may have a slightly longer transit time due to the need to consolidate goods at the port. LCL shipping is also typically available with a CIF option, where the seller covers the cost, insurance, and freight up to Maizuru Port.
Estimated Transit Time
The shipping transit time from Guangzhou or Shenzhen to Maizuru Port is typically around 10 days, depending on the shipping line and route. This timeline includes the time taken for the container to be loaded at the port, transported by sea, and unloaded at Maizuru. Additional time for customs clearance and final delivery should also be factored into the overall shipment time.

Packaging of Window Cleaning Machines
Proper packaging is crucial to ensure that the window cleaning machines are transported safely and securely. Here are the recommended steps for packaging:
Protective Wrapping
The machines should be wrapped in high-quality bubble wrap or foam sheets to prevent scratches or damage during transit. Special attention should be paid to any delicate parts of the machine, such as controls, nozzles, or glass components.Use of Wooden Crates or Pallets
For both FCL and LCL shipments, it is advisable to place the window cleaning machines on wooden pallets or within wooden crates. This provides extra stability and protection against physical impacts during handling and transport. The pallets or crates should be securely sealed, and any sharp edges should be padded with foam or padding material.Labeling and Documentation
Each package should be clearly labeled with the necessary details, including the destination (Maizuru Port), handling instructions (e.g., “Fragile,” “Keep Dry”), and any special requirements. Make sure that all customs documents, such as the commercial invoice, packing list, and Bill of Lading, are included and correctly filled out.Container Loading
For FCL shipments, the containers should be packed tightly, ensuring the window cleaning machines are stable and cannot move around during transit. Proper blocking and bracing inside the container are essential to prevent shifting during sea transport. If you are using LCL, the goods will be consolidated into a shared container, and extra precautions should be taken to ensure that your machines are well-protected in the shared space.
